After a near perfect start to the campaign, Pulis’s former side, Stoke City, are the visitors to the Hawthorns this weekend for the early televised game on Sunday with the Welshman looking to retain his record of never having been a losing manager in a fixture between the clubs.
Tuesday evening will see the first ever meeting between Accrington Stanley and West Bromwich Albion and, of course, the Baggies’ first ever visit to the Wham Stadium for the second round tie of the newly-named Carabao Cup.
Back-to-back wins at the start of a Premier League season for the first time put the Baggies in second place in the table on Saturday evening, their highest ever position in the Premier League, although Huddersfield’s win on Sunday pushed Albion down to third.
